Dölj textöverspill i Excel med GroupDocs.Viewer för Java
När du hide text overflow Excel celler medan du konverterar ett kalkylblad till HTML, ser resultatet rent och professionellt ut. I den här handledningen går vi igenom de exakta stegen för att förhindra rörigt överspill, med hjälp av GroupDocs.Viewer för Java. Du kommer att se hur du konfigurerar viewer, bäddar in resurser och renderar din Excel-arbetsbok så att all text som överskrider en cells gränser helt enkelt döljs.

Snabba svar
- Vad gör “hide text overflow excel”? Det undertrycker allt cellinnehåll som överskrider cellens bredd eller höjd vid HTML-rendering.
- Vilket bibliotek hanterar detta? GroupDocs.Viewer för Java tillhandahåller
TextOverflowMode.HIDE_TEXT-alternativet. - Behöver jag en licens? En tillfällig licens finns tillgänglig för utvärdering; en full licens krävs för produktion.
- Kan jag också konvertera Excel till HTML? Ja – samma viewer konverterar Excel-filer till HTML samtidigt som overflow-inställningen tillämpas.
- Är detta tillvägagångssätt lämpligt för stora arbetsböcker? Absolut, följ bara prestandatipsen i avsnittet “Performance Considerations”.
Vad är hide text overflow excel?
hide text overflow excel är ett renderingsläge som instruerar viewer att klippa av all text som annars skulle spilla utanför de definierade cellgränserna när ett Excel-ark omvandlas till HTML. Detta håller layouten prydlig, särskilt för instrumentpaneler eller rapporter som visas i webbläsare.
Varför använda GroupDocs.Viewer för att konvertera excel till html?
GroupDocs.Viewer erbjuder en snabb, server‑sidig lösning för convert excel to html utan att kräva Microsoft Office på servern. Det stödjer ett brett spektrum av Excel-funktioner och ger dig fin‑granulär kontroll över hur celler visas — till exempel att dölja överflödig text.
Förutsättningar
- Java Development Kit (JDK) – version 8 eller nyare.
- Maven – för beroendehantering.
- Grundläggande Java‑kunskaper och en IDE (IntelliJ IDEA, Eclipse, etc.).
Konfigurera GroupDocs.Viewer för Java
Lägg till viewer‑biblioteket i ditt Maven‑projekt.
Maven‑beroende
<repositories>
<repository>
<id>repository.groupdocs.com</id>
<name>GroupDocs Repository</name>
<url>https://releases.groupdocs.com/viewer/java/</url>
</repository>
</repositories>
<dependencies>
<dependency>
<groupId>com.groupdocs</groupId>
<artifactId>groupdocs-viewer</artifactId>
<version>25.2</version>
</dependency>
</dependencies>
Licensanskaffning
Skaffa en tillfällig licens för att låsa upp alla funktioner:
- Free Trial: Ladda ner den senaste versionen från GroupDocs Releases.
- Temporary License: Begär via GroupDocs Temporary License Page.
- Purchase: Köp en full licens på GroupDocs Purchase Page.
Implementeringsguide
Nedan följer en steg‑för‑steg‑genomgång som behåller de ursprungliga kodblocken intakta samtidigt som tydliga förklaringar läggs till.
Steg 1: Definiera utdatamapp
Ange var de renderade HTML‑filerna ska sparas.
Path outputDirectory = Utils.getOutputDirectoryPath("YOUR_OUTPUT_DIRECTORY");
Förklaring: Utils.getOutputDirectoryPath skapar (eller återanvänder) en mapp med namnet YOUR_OUTPUT_DIRECTORY i projektets utdatamapp.
Steg 2: Konfigurera sidfilssökväg
Skapa ett namnmönster för varje genererad HTML‑sida.
Path pageFilePathFormat = outputDirectory.resolve("page_{0}.html");
Förklaring: {0} är en platshållare som viewer ersätter med sidnumret, vilket ger dig filer som page_1.html, page_2.html osv.
Steg 3: Ställ in HtmlViewOptions
Berätta för viewer att bädda in resurser och dölja överflödig celltext.
HtmlViewOptions viewOptions = HtmlViewOptions.forEmbeddedResources(pageFilePathFormat);
viewOptions.getSpreadsheetOptions().setTextOverflowMode(TextOverflowMode.HIDE_TEXT);
Förklaring: TextOverflowMode.HIDE_TEXT är den viktigaste inställningen som prevent overflow in excel celler under render excel to html‑processen.
Steg 4: Rendera ditt dokument
Kör viewer med de konfigurerade alternativen.
try (Viewer viewer = new Viewer(TestFiles.SAMPLE_XLSX_WITH_TEXT_OVERFLOW)) {
viewer.view(viewOptions);
}
Förklaring: view‑metoden läser exempelarbetsboken, tillämpar overflow‑regeln och skriver HTML‑filerna till den tidigare definierade mappen.
Vanliga användningsområden och fördelar
- Web Portals – Visa finansiella tabeller utan att långa strängar bryter layouten.
- Data Analytics Dashboards – Håll stora dataset läsbara genom att dölja överflödig text.
- Customer Reporting – Leverera rena, utskriftsvänliga HTML‑rapporter.
Genom att använda hide text overflow excel, säkerställer du att den visuella presentationen förblir konsekvent över webbläsare och enheter.
Prestandaöverväganden
- Memory Management – Frigör
Viewer‑instansen omedelbart (som visas med try‑with‑resources). - Embedded Resources – Inbäddning av bilder och stilar minskar antalet HTTP‑förfrågningar men ökar HTML‑storleken; välj det läge som passar dina bandbreddsbegränsningar.
- Caching – Spara renderad HTML för ofta åtkomna arbetsböcker för att undvika ombearbetning.
Vanliga frågor
Q1: What is GroupDocs.Viewer for Java?
A1: Det är ett Java‑bibliotek som renderar över 100 dokumentformat (inklusive Excel) till HTML, PDF, PNG och mer, utan att behöva Microsoft Office på servern.
Q2: How do I handle large Excel files with text overflow?
A2: Använd TextOverflowMode.HIDE_TEXT som visat, och överväg att aktivera caching eller bearbeta filen i delar för att minska minnesbelastningen.
Q3: Can I customize the HTML output further?
A3: Ja. HtmlViewOptions erbjuder många inställningar — såsom anpassad CSS, bildhantering och sidstorlekskontroll.
Q4: What are common pitfalls when using this feature?
A4: Att glömma att frigöra Viewer‑instansen, eller att använda standard‑overflow‑läget (som visar texten) istället för HIDE_TEXT.
Q5: Where can I get more help or examples?
A5: Besök GroupDocs Support Forum för community‑hjälp och officiell dokumentation.
Slutsats
Genom att följa stegen ovan kan du hide text overflow Excel celler när du convert excel to html med GroupDocs.Viewer för Java. Denna enkla konfiguration förbättrar avsevärt läsbarheten för renderade kalkylblad och passar sömlöst in i webbaserade rapporteringslösningar.
Resurser
- Documentation: GroupDocs.Viewer Java Documentation
- API Reference: GroupDocs API Reference
- Download: GroupDocs Downloads
- Purchase: Buy GroupDocs License
- Free Trial: GroupDocs Free Trial
- Temporary License: Request Temporary License
Senast uppdaterad: 2025-12-18
Testad med: GroupDocs.Viewer 25.2 för Java
Författare: GroupDocs